Output 5580d3bee86e1c4339ac1dd31e0325682b33f71b9d8ba840cc261fcf711d620a:0

value
2022839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b2dd1f966a2d9a7f047f29e37eed45dc2f5446f OP_EQUAL
address
3Qb8RLWzY2p6SVvRECn1a5AgkorVAmK8mB
transaction
5580d3bee86e1c4339ac1dd31e0325682b33f71b9d8ba840cc261fcf711d620a
spent
true